Crosscutters Suffer 3-2 Home Loss
|
The rain could not keep the home crowd from enjoying a good ballgame.
The Batavia Muckdogs picked up a win at Bowman Field, defeating the Williamsport Crosscutters, 3-2. Starting pitcher Andy Martin was an essential part of his team's success. With the victory, the Muckdogs upped their record to 38-32.
Batavia used the hitting of Lance Underwood to pick up the win. The left fielder clubbed a solo home run in the top of the second inning to put the Muckdogs on top, 3-0. For the game, Underwood had 1 home run and 1 single in 3 at-bats.
Williamsport manager B.J. Olenchuk said he was "mildly disappointed" with the loss. "We had our opportunities, but we didn't take advantage of them," he said.
